Original Description
George Inness's Autumn Landscape (c. 1891) captures the serene melancholy of fall with a masterful blend of tonalism and subdued impressionism. Hazy golden light filters through thinning foliage, softening the contours of dark trees and a tranquil pond, evoking a dreamlike communion with nature. Painted late in his career, this work reflects Inness’s spiritual connection to the landscape—influenced by Swedenborgianism, which saw divine harmony in natural forms. Unlike the Hudson River School’s grand vistas, Inness embraced mood over detail, pioneering American tonalism’s poetic ambiguity. Today, the piece is celebrated as a bridge between romanticism and modernism, its atmospheric glow predating Whistler’s nocturnes and influencing the Ashcan School’s softer interpretations.
